
Last year in Chiang Mai, Thailand, people were certain that a bomb had exploded. As it was revealed later, what caused the loud noises were loose wires on the road.
Though initially there seemed to be no severe injuries in the aftermath, 49-year-old Walai Sriboonvorakul, was walking around the neighborhood when she noticed something shocking. There was a helpless, approximately 1-year-old cat on the ground, who was missing its front legs and tail. The poor animal had been electrocuted by the wires on the road and looked like it was in a hopeless state.
Nevertheless, Walai decided not to give up on the little cat, whom she affectionately called “Able.” The woman brought him to her house, to help him recover.


Now Able is a happy, healthy cat. Even though at first it was difficult for him to move, the care and affection that he received from Walai and her 26-year-old son Copter, only helped the cat grow stronger.
After Able was allowed to roam freely, he now has no trouble getting around!
